Ambient temperature
The 3RT2 contactors are dimensioned as standard for operation at ambient temperatures of
between -25 °C and +60 °C. Up to 60 °C, side-by-side mounting can be used without any
restriction. The devices can be stored at temperatures within the range from
-55 °C to +80 °C.
Size S00 and S0 contactors can be used at higher ambient temperatures, but various
constraints must be considered. The 3RT20 contactors can be operated continuously at an
ambient temperature of Ta > 60 °C, taking the following points into account:
Thermal load capacity of the main current paths
The standard contactors are dimensioned for a maximum ambient temperature of
Ta = 60 °C. In order to use the contactors at higher ambient temperatures of up to 70 °C, the
rated operational current I
e
/AC-1 or I
e
/DC-1 and the switching frequency z must be reduced.
The following linear dependencies can be applied here:

The contactors may be operated for 1 hour at an ambient temperature of up to Ta ≤ 80 °C
without reducing the permissible currents. Nevertheless, the average ambient temperature
must not exceed Ta ≤ 60 °C for any 24 hour period. Note, however, that contactors which
contain electronic components or which are combined with electronic accessories
(e.g. integrated overvoltage attenuation, etc.) may only be operated at an ambient
temperature of up to Ta ≤ 60 °C.
Minimum clearances from adjacent components
The 3RT2 contactors are dimensioned for side-by-side mounting at temperatures of up to
+60 °C. At higher temperatures a clearance of 10 mm may be required in order to ensure
better heat dissipation with side-by-side mounting.
Operating range of the contactor drive
All SIRIUS contactors comply with the operating range limits of 0.85 to 1.1 x U
S
(rated
control supply voltage) stipulated in standard IEC EN 60947. The majority of the devices
feature an operating range of 0.8 to 1.1 x U
S
, on some versions it is 0.7 to 1.3 x U
S
.
